Multi-factor authentication (MFA) plays a crucial role in securing access to systems and data by adding an extra layer of security beyond just a username and password. This additional layer typically involves something the user has (such as a smartphone or security token) or something the user is (such as a fingerprint or facial recognition), making it significantly more difficult for unauthorized users to gain access.
By requiring multiple forms of verification, MFA reduces the risk of unauthorized access resulting from compromised credentials, such as stolen or guessed passwords. This significantly enhances the security posture of systems and data by ensuring that only authorized individuals with proper authentication factors can access them. As a result, MFA has become a cornerstone of modern cybersecurity strategies, especially in sectors where data protection is critical, such as finance, healthcare, and government.
